Path Traversal in Siyuan-note Siyuan
CVE-2026-32749
SiYuan is a personal knowledge management system. In versions 3.6.0 and below, POST /api/import/importSY and POST /api/import/importZipMd write uploaded archives to a path derived from the multipart filename field without sanitization, all…
EPSS: 0.001 (31.0th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 7.6 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:H/UI:N/S:C/C:L/I:H/A:N.
Affected products
- Siyuan-note Siyuan — versions < 3.6.1
